PROVINCIAL FRENCH ANTIQUE OBJECTS & FOLK ART

Provincial French Antique Objects of Everyday Life (Art Populaire : Les objets anciens de la vie quotidienne régionale). Selling part two of a collection of 18th-19th c. country and folk art items of utilitarian pottery, kitchen and work-related utensils, rustic furniture, and curiosities. FRENCH GLAZED ANTIQUE CERAMIC "CUIT POMMES": Provencal "cuit pommes" (cooked/steamed apples). This poterie was placed near the chimney to slowly warm the apples. This gave off a pleasant smell that permeated the house. Dimensions: H 3.25" x W
